Luneta Park of Surigao City


This is the Luneta Park of the peaceful and clean city of Surigao.
Surigao City is in the south part of the Philippines. It is called the gateway of Mindanao, because it is where the journey of Mindanao starts. It has considered the 2nd class city in the province of Surigao del Norte. It has the population of 131,151 and its total land area is 245.34 sq. km.
Surigao City is rich in marine products. It has many historical places and events. The people there are friendly. Living is affordable.
